Literature summary extracted from

  • Marcia, M.; Langer, J.D.; Parcej, D.; Vogel, V.; Peng, G.; Michel, H.
    Characterizing a monotopic membrane enzyme. Biochemical, enzymatic and crystallization studies on Aquifex aeolicus sulfide:quinone oxidoreductase (2010), Biochim. Biophys. Acta, 1798, 2114-2123.

Storage Stability

EC Number Storage Stability Organism
1.8.5.4 4C, protein is stable and monodisperse in 50 mM dodecyl-D-maltoside for weeks, either in the absence of salt or in the presence of N 1 M NaCl Aquifex aeolicus
1.8.5.4 4°C, purified protein in 3% (w/v) dodecyl-beta-D-maltoside either in the absence of salt or in the presence of N 1 M NaCl, six weeks, no loss of activity Aquifex aeolicus
1.8.5.4 80°C, purified protein in 3% (w/v) dodecyl-beta-D-maltoside either in the absence of salt or in the presence of N 1 M NaCl, one day, 50% loss of activity Aquifex aeolicus
